Disaster Management nominated for Service Excellence

19 April 2021

The Department of Local Government celebrates Disaster Management's team nomination in the 2020 Service Excellence Awards.

Disaster Management team celebrate Excellence Awards NominationThe nomination comes on the back of the stellar service provided by the directorate, during the nation-wide lockdown. The team was nominated for excellence in the 'Barrier Breaker' category, which recognises public servants for their commitment to citizen-centeredness and dedicated teamwork across different areas. 

During the hard lockdown the Disaster Management Centre operated for 24-hours a day, 7 days a week, and on public holidays. Staff worked 12-hour shifts, with 100% of the staff compliment working in teams, to serve the public during the Covid-19 pandemic.  

The Department of Local Government is pleased with this nomination and sends the team at Disaster Management the very best of luck as they await the final outcome. The nomination itself holds great prestige and it is "a pleasure to see the great level of service delivery and dedication this team has shown", the Department said.
